Ordinals
beta
Sat 1502666595774058
decimal
391066.1595774058
degree
0°181066′1978″1595774058‴
percentile
71.5555522584282%
name
dezjxvheuap
cycle
0
epoch
1
period
193
block
391066
offset
1595774058
timestamp
2015-12-31 04:38:17 UTC
rarity
common
prev
next